Output 40d3bfbd47aa781d33a23b99da30b581cc0a86e3bb658bab153f91f6006dc949:0

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76c57ce6c95cdc1f79768b2d37aee9d70be7e57b OP_EQUAL
address
3CX2EsxPf3FNGGMivpHybFKcGBYvKqJSUk
transaction
40d3bfbd47aa781d33a23b99da30b581cc0a86e3bb658bab153f91f6006dc949
spent
true